Modern Mom Style Box review: TLDR

Here’s the quick download on Modern Mom Style Box and how it works:

  • You select your own garments. This isn’t a personal shopper service like Stitch Fix. To receive your first style box, you must select at least five garments. You can mark items as “high priority” if you want to receive them faster.
  • You receive three garments in every box. Wear them once or five times. It doesn’t matter.
  • You don’t have to wash or dry clean anything — just send it back when you’re done. If you still have five or more pieces saved, Modern Mom Style Box ships out another box.
  • Shipping both ways is included.
  • If you want to keep any of your rented clothes, you can buy them at a discount.
  • The catalog is a nice mix of classics and trendy pieces.

Modern Mom Style Box vs. competitors

See the table below for a head-to-head comparison of the three big clothing rental subscriptions, Le Tote, Haverdash, and Modern Mom Style Box.

Subscription Monthly Price   Box Limits Each Box Includes  
Le Tote $59-$119 1 Tote Monthly 5-10 garments monthly. Some plans also include 3-5 accessories.
Le Tote Unlimited $79 Unlimited 3 garments + 2 accessories or 4 garments.
Haverdash $59 Unlimited 3 garments.
Modern Mom Style Box $60 Unlimited 3 garments.

As you can see, all three have a plan at the $59 or $60 per month price point. Le Tote’s cheapest plan limits you to one box monthly with five garments. Haverdash and Modern Mom Style Box offer unlimited boxes with three garments each.

Le Tote additionally has more expensive plans that deliver more garments and, optionally, accessories.

My strategy for choosing rental pieces  

Renting clothes can push your clothing spend higher if you’re not careful. Here’s what can happen. You pick out a garment you’re dying to try. It arrives and you realize you need one more thing to create the perfectly chic ensemble. Now you’re on Amazon looking for the right top or shoes or whatever. Once you’ve made that purchase, you’re more likely to buy the rented piece…

That’s a shopping spiral. It gets expensive.

You can sidestep that mess. Before saving any piece to your rental account, think about how it fits with your existing wardrobe. Ideally, your rental pieces should extend the versatility of clothes you already own. That’s how you maximize the value of your $60 monthly rental fee.

Also, dresses and jumpsuits make great rentals because you need only add shoes and a bag. For this reason, I’ll lean into bolder styles for those pieces. It’s a great opportunity to experiment without commitment.

The story of the Modern Mom

Tara Clark, author of Modern Mom Probs: A Survival Guide for 21st Century Mothers, founded Modern Mom Style Box in the second half of 2021. She had the idea for a clothing rental service 20 years ago. At the time, she was fresh out of college and didn’t have a huge budget for work clothes.

Back then, her coworkers laughed at her idea. Today, it’s clear Clark was ahead of her time. When it comes to fashion — especially fashion for busy moms — there are compelling reasons to rent more and buy less:

  1. Renting keeps your wardrobe fresh.
  2. Renting saves you money.
  3. Renting extends the life of clothes and keeps garments out of landfills.  
  4. Renting saves you time. You don’t have to wash or dry clean the pieces you wear. Just send them back dirty and let Modern Mom Style Box handle it.
